She spent a decade working in the entertainment industry before a cervical cancer diagnosis at the age of 30. Despite facing a treatment plan that would ensure infertility, Tracy’s insurance company denied her claim to preserve fertility as ‘elective’ – as if anyone would choose to have a tumor.
